Cashner seems to be all recovered from what he called a “hot finger” (I can’t stop laughing at that) that kept him out of a planned start against Boston last week. His last start, on Monday against Oakland, went pretty well: an earned run in six innings, although he got the loss because the run support he’s enjoyed for most of the season has evaporated of late. Cashner has pretty good numbers against the Mariners hitters he’s faced. First baseman Ryon Healy is 0-for-9, catcher Omar Narvaez 0-for-2 (with four walks!), CF Mallex Smith 0-for-11 with 3 strikeouts, 2B Dee Gordon 4-for-16 with a walk, and 3B Kyle Seager 7-for-25 with four walks.
On the hill for the M’s is lefty Tommy Milone (1-1, 3.03 ERA), who’s bounced back and forth between the rotation and the bullpen for Seattle this season, pitching competently in both roles. Milone is a control guy, which usually doesn’t work out well for this lineup, but as a reminder, the splits are better against lefties, .247 BA/.392 OBP/.687 OPS (against righties: .232/.392/.687). The only Orioles who’ve seen Milone are Alberto (0-for-2), Villar (3-for-8 with a walk and a double), and Chris Davis, who has a surprising .357 average against him in 16 at-bats, including two home runs.
